Use the Cricut Explore and the associated internet based Design Space software to create some fun decorations for Halloween. This project makes a tantalising sign measuring 9 inch x 18 inch. It is made up of six layers to give strength and rigidity. Alternatively, it could be cut from thick grey board and painted; the deep cut blade and housing unit would be required for the Explore.

Step-1
Log on to your Design Space account and connect the Cricut Explore to the pc / Mac. Search the categories list for ‘parties & events’ and click on the ‘Something Wicked’ project.
Step-2
To create the project as designed, click on ‘Make it Now’. To change or re-size the project, click on ‘Customise’.
Top tip! Use the scraper tool to apply the resource to the mat; ensures good adhesion and no air bubbles. Remove the images from the mat using the spatula; prevents damage to the image and mat.
Step-3
Cut the images out from card and vinyl, loading them on to the cutting mat and adjusting the Smart Dial accordingly.
Top tip! Ink the edges of the white layers first using a grey ink to give dimension.
Step-4
Glue all the black skeleton layers together then the white layers on top.
Top tip! Ink the edges of the ‘WICKED’ letters using green ink to give dimension.
Step-5
Glue the grey wording layers together. Using the transfer tape, apply the vinyl wording over the top. Layer the green ‘WICKED’ images on to the wording piece.
Step-6
Punch holes in the ‘W’ and push through the black brads.
Step-7
Punch holes towards the top of the wording and the lower side of the arm. Attach a jump ring to each hole and join the two pieces together using chain.
